<?xml version="1.0" encoding="UTF-8"?>
<rss xmlns:content="http://purl.org/rss/1.0/modules/content/" xmlns:dc="http://purl.org/dc/elements/1.1/" xmlns:rdf="http://www.w3.org/1999/02/22-rdf-syntax-ns#" xmlns:taxo="http://purl.org/rss/1.0/modules/taxonomy/" version="2.0">
  <channel>
    <title>i.MX ProcessorsのトピックIMX8QM Display port</title>
    <link>https://community.nxp.com/t5/i-MX-Processors/IMX8QM-Display-port/m-p/2306580#M243836</link>
    <description>&lt;P&gt;Hi,&lt;/P&gt;&lt;P&gt;I am trying to use the display port with an IMX8QM on a custom board.&lt;/P&gt;&lt;P&gt;With the kernel from freescale 6.6.101 and the last dpfw.bin I am getting the following errors :&lt;/P&gt;&lt;BLOCKQUOTE&gt;&lt;P&gt;[drm] Started firmware!&lt;BR /&gt;[drm] set maximum defer retry to 5&lt;BR /&gt;[drm] HDP FW Version - ver 35083 verlib 20560&lt;BR /&gt;[drm] Only HDCP 2.2 is enabled&lt;/P&gt;&lt;P&gt;[ 117.275150] cdns-mhdp-imx 56268000.hdmi: [drm:cdns_mhdp_mailbox_validate_receive [cdns_mhdp_drmcore]] Hmmm spurious mailbox data maybe, cleaning out…1:2:130 vs 1:2:2&lt;BR /&gt;[ 117.300044] cdns-mhdp-imx 56268000.hdmi: [drm:cdns_mhdp_mailbox_validate_receive [cdns_mhdp_drmcore]] Hmmm spurious mailbox data maybe, cleaning out…1:2:130 vs 1:2:2&lt;BR /&gt;[ 117.324855] cdns-mhdp-imx 56268000.hdmi: [drm:cdns_mhdp_mailbox_validate_receive [cdns_mhdp_drmcore]] Hmmm spurious mailbox data maybe, cleaning out…1:2:130 vs 1:2:2&lt;BR /&gt;[ 117.349728] cdns-mhdp-imx 56268000.hdmi: [drm:cdns_mhdp_mailbox_validate_receive [cdns_mhdp_drmcore]] Hmmm spurious mailbox data maybe, cleaning out…1:2:130 vs 1:2:2&lt;BR /&gt;[ 117.367633] cdns-mhdp-imx 56268000.hdmi: [drm:cdns_mhdp_get_edid_block [cdns_mhdp_drmcore]]&lt;SPAN&gt;&amp;nbsp;&lt;/SPAN&gt;&lt;EM&gt;ERROR&lt;/EM&gt;&lt;SPAN&gt;&amp;nbsp;&lt;/SPAN&gt;get block[0] edid failed: -22&lt;BR /&gt;[ 117.380368] [drm:cdns_dp_connector_get_modes [cdns_mhdp_drmcore]]&lt;SPAN&gt;&amp;nbsp;&lt;/SPAN&gt;&lt;EM&gt;ERROR&lt;/EM&gt;&lt;SPAN&gt;&amp;nbsp;&lt;/SPAN&gt;Invalid edid&lt;BR /&gt;[ 117.455078] cdns-mhdp-imx 56268000.hdmi: [drm:cdns_mhdp_mailbox_validate_receive [cdns_mhdp_drmcore]] Hmmm spurious mailbox data maybe, cleaning out…1:3:6 vs 1:3:5&lt;BR /&gt;[ 117.477757] cdns-mhdp-imx 56268000.hdmi: [drm:cdns_mhdp_mailbox_validate_receive [cdns_mhdp_drmcore]] Hmmm spurious mailbox data maybe, cleaning out…1:3:6 vs 1:3:5&lt;BR /&gt;[ 117.500832] cdns-mhdp-imx 56268000.hdmi: [drm:cdns_mhdp_mailbox_validate_receive [cdns_mhdp_drmcore]] Hmmm spurious mailbox data maybe, cleaning out…1:3:6 vs 1:3:5&lt;BR /&gt;[ 117.522285] cdns-mhdp-imx 56268000.hdmi: [drm:cdns_mhdp_mailbox_validate_receive [cdns_mhdp_drmcore]] Hmmm spurious mailbox data maybe, cleaning out…1:3:6 vs 1:3:5&lt;BR /&gt;[ 117.543825] cdns-mhdp-imx 56268000.hdmi: [drm:cdns_mhdp_mailbox_validate_receive [cdns_mhdp_drmcore]] Hmmm spurious mailbox data maybe, cleaning out…1:3:6 vs 1:3:5&lt;BR /&gt;[ 117.565803] cdns-mhdp-imx 56268000.hdmi: [drm:cdns_mhdp_mailbox_validate_receive [cdns_mhdp_drmcore]] Hmmm spurious mailbox data maybe, cleaning out…1:3:6 vs 1:3:5&lt;/P&gt;&lt;/BLOCKQUOTE&gt;&lt;P&gt;I tried to use others version of the dpfw without success.&lt;/P&gt;&lt;P&gt;In my dts file I use this to use the DP :&lt;/P&gt;&lt;BLOCKQUOTE&gt;&lt;P&gt;&amp;amp;hdmi {&lt;BR /&gt;status = “okay”;&lt;BR /&gt;compatible = “cdn,imx8qm-dp”;&lt;BR /&gt;firmware-name = “dpfw.bin”;&lt;BR /&gt;lane-mapping = &amp;lt;0x1b&amp;gt;;&lt;BR /&gt;hdcp-config = &amp;lt;0x2&amp;gt;;&lt;BR /&gt;};&lt;/P&gt;&lt;/BLOCKQUOTE&gt;&lt;P&gt;The kernel error I wrote just before occur when the HPD change his level from low to high.&lt;BR /&gt;I see datas on the AUX pins of the DP.&lt;/P&gt;&lt;P&gt;With the kernel 6.6.94 and the dpfw.bin compiled from yocto the errors are identical.&lt;/P&gt;&lt;P&gt;Any idea ?&lt;/P&gt;</description>
    <pubDate>Wed, 04 Feb 2026 11:12:57 GMT</pubDate>
    <dc:creator>Rbe78</dc:creator>
    <dc:date>2026-02-04T11:12:57Z</dc:date>
    <item>
      <title>IMX8QM Display port</title>
      <link>https://community.nxp.com/t5/i-MX-Processors/IMX8QM-Display-port/m-p/2306580#M243836</link>
      <description>&lt;P&gt;Hi,&lt;/P&gt;&lt;P&gt;I am trying to use the display port with an IMX8QM on a custom board.&lt;/P&gt;&lt;P&gt;With the kernel from freescale 6.6.101 and the last dpfw.bin I am getting the following errors :&lt;/P&gt;&lt;BLOCKQUOTE&gt;&lt;P&gt;[drm] Started firmware!&lt;BR /&gt;[drm] set maximum defer retry to 5&lt;BR /&gt;[drm] HDP FW Version - ver 35083 verlib 20560&lt;BR /&gt;[drm] Only HDCP 2.2 is enabled&lt;/P&gt;&lt;P&gt;[ 117.275150] cdns-mhdp-imx 56268000.hdmi: [drm:cdns_mhdp_mailbox_validate_receive [cdns_mhdp_drmcore]] Hmmm spurious mailbox data maybe, cleaning out…1:2:130 vs 1:2:2&lt;BR /&gt;[ 117.300044] cdns-mhdp-imx 56268000.hdmi: [drm:cdns_mhdp_mailbox_validate_receive [cdns_mhdp_drmcore]] Hmmm spurious mailbox data maybe, cleaning out…1:2:130 vs 1:2:2&lt;BR /&gt;[ 117.324855] cdns-mhdp-imx 56268000.hdmi: [drm:cdns_mhdp_mailbox_validate_receive [cdns_mhdp_drmcore]] Hmmm spurious mailbox data maybe, cleaning out…1:2:130 vs 1:2:2&lt;BR /&gt;[ 117.349728] cdns-mhdp-imx 56268000.hdmi: [drm:cdns_mhdp_mailbox_validate_receive [cdns_mhdp_drmcore]] Hmmm spurious mailbox data maybe, cleaning out…1:2:130 vs 1:2:2&lt;BR /&gt;[ 117.367633] cdns-mhdp-imx 56268000.hdmi: [drm:cdns_mhdp_get_edid_block [cdns_mhdp_drmcore]]&lt;SPAN&gt;&amp;nbsp;&lt;/SPAN&gt;&lt;EM&gt;ERROR&lt;/EM&gt;&lt;SPAN&gt;&amp;nbsp;&lt;/SPAN&gt;get block[0] edid failed: -22&lt;BR /&gt;[ 117.380368] [drm:cdns_dp_connector_get_modes [cdns_mhdp_drmcore]]&lt;SPAN&gt;&amp;nbsp;&lt;/SPAN&gt;&lt;EM&gt;ERROR&lt;/EM&gt;&lt;SPAN&gt;&amp;nbsp;&lt;/SPAN&gt;Invalid edid&lt;BR /&gt;[ 117.455078] cdns-mhdp-imx 56268000.hdmi: [drm:cdns_mhdp_mailbox_validate_receive [cdns_mhdp_drmcore]] Hmmm spurious mailbox data maybe, cleaning out…1:3:6 vs 1:3:5&lt;BR /&gt;[ 117.477757] cdns-mhdp-imx 56268000.hdmi: [drm:cdns_mhdp_mailbox_validate_receive [cdns_mhdp_drmcore]] Hmmm spurious mailbox data maybe, cleaning out…1:3:6 vs 1:3:5&lt;BR /&gt;[ 117.500832] cdns-mhdp-imx 56268000.hdmi: [drm:cdns_mhdp_mailbox_validate_receive [cdns_mhdp_drmcore]] Hmmm spurious mailbox data maybe, cleaning out…1:3:6 vs 1:3:5&lt;BR /&gt;[ 117.522285] cdns-mhdp-imx 56268000.hdmi: [drm:cdns_mhdp_mailbox_validate_receive [cdns_mhdp_drmcore]] Hmmm spurious mailbox data maybe, cleaning out…1:3:6 vs 1:3:5&lt;BR /&gt;[ 117.543825] cdns-mhdp-imx 56268000.hdmi: [drm:cdns_mhdp_mailbox_validate_receive [cdns_mhdp_drmcore]] Hmmm spurious mailbox data maybe, cleaning out…1:3:6 vs 1:3:5&lt;BR /&gt;[ 117.565803] cdns-mhdp-imx 56268000.hdmi: [drm:cdns_mhdp_mailbox_validate_receive [cdns_mhdp_drmcore]] Hmmm spurious mailbox data maybe, cleaning out…1:3:6 vs 1:3:5&lt;/P&gt;&lt;/BLOCKQUOTE&gt;&lt;P&gt;I tried to use others version of the dpfw without success.&lt;/P&gt;&lt;P&gt;In my dts file I use this to use the DP :&lt;/P&gt;&lt;BLOCKQUOTE&gt;&lt;P&gt;&amp;amp;hdmi {&lt;BR /&gt;status = “okay”;&lt;BR /&gt;compatible = “cdn,imx8qm-dp”;&lt;BR /&gt;firmware-name = “dpfw.bin”;&lt;BR /&gt;lane-mapping = &amp;lt;0x1b&amp;gt;;&lt;BR /&gt;hdcp-config = &amp;lt;0x2&amp;gt;;&lt;BR /&gt;};&lt;/P&gt;&lt;/BLOCKQUOTE&gt;&lt;P&gt;The kernel error I wrote just before occur when the HPD change his level from low to high.&lt;BR /&gt;I see datas on the AUX pins of the DP.&lt;/P&gt;&lt;P&gt;With the kernel 6.6.94 and the dpfw.bin compiled from yocto the errors are identical.&lt;/P&gt;&lt;P&gt;Any idea ?&lt;/P&gt;</description>
      <pubDate>Wed, 04 Feb 2026 11:12:57 GMT</pubDate>
      <guid>https://community.nxp.com/t5/i-MX-Processors/IMX8QM-Display-port/m-p/2306580#M243836</guid>
      <dc:creator>Rbe78</dc:creator>
      <dc:date>2026-02-04T11:12:57Z</dc:date>
    </item>
    <item>
      <title>Re: IMX8QM Display port</title>
      <link>https://community.nxp.com/t5/i-MX-Processors/IMX8QM-Display-port/m-p/2313365#M243884</link>
      <description>&lt;P&gt;this firmware is align to the nxp official bsp, I suggest that you can use nxp official bsp version&lt;/P&gt;
&lt;P&gt;&lt;A href="https://www.nxp.com/design/design-center/software/embedded-software/i-mx-software/embedded-linux-for-i-mx-applications-processors:IMXLINUX" target="_blank"&gt;https://www.nxp.com/design/design-center/software/embedded-software/i-mx-software/embedded-linux-for-i-mx-applications-processors:IMXLINUX&lt;/A&gt;&lt;/P&gt;
&lt;P&gt;&amp;nbsp;&lt;/P&gt;</description>
      <pubDate>Fri, 06 Feb 2026 04:21:12 GMT</pubDate>
      <guid>https://community.nxp.com/t5/i-MX-Processors/IMX8QM-Display-port/m-p/2313365#M243884</guid>
      <dc:creator>joanxie</dc:creator>
      <dc:date>2026-02-06T04:21:12Z</dc:date>
    </item>
    <item>
      <title>Re: IMX8QM Display port</title>
      <link>https://community.nxp.com/t5/i-MX-Processors/IMX8QM-Display-port/m-p/2317922#M244029</link>
      <description>&lt;P&gt;I just tried the kernel in the package gived by NXP : L6.6.52_2.2.2_MX8QM&lt;/P&gt;&lt;P&gt;The kernel 6.6.52 boots but I have now this following errors :&amp;nbsp;&lt;/P&gt;&lt;BLOCKQUOTE&gt;&lt;P&gt;[ 5.360352] [drm] Started firmware!&lt;BR /&gt;[ 6.021326] [drm:cdns_mhdp_firmware_init_imx8qm [cdns_mhdp_imx]] *ERROR* NO HDMI FW running&lt;BR /&gt;[ 6.657181] [drm:__cdns_dp_probe [cdns_mhdp_drmcore]] *ERROR* NO dp FW running&lt;BR /&gt;[ 6.664860] imx-drm display-subsystem: failed to bind 56268000.hdmi (ops cdns_mhdp_imx_ops [cdns_mhdp_imx]): -6&lt;BR /&gt;[ 6.676112] imx-drm display-subsystem: adev bind failed: -6&lt;/P&gt;&lt;/BLOCKQUOTE&gt;&lt;P&gt;But when I rename the file dpfw.bin the kernel displays this error :&lt;/P&gt;&lt;BLOCKQUOTE&gt;&lt;P&gt;[ 5.462856] cdns-mhdp-imx 56268000.hdmi: Direct firmware load for dpfw.bin failed with error -2&lt;/P&gt;&lt;/BLOCKQUOTE&gt;&lt;P&gt;The firmware looks loaded in my case but it do not run ?&lt;BR /&gt;This is the firmware I found in the package.&lt;/P&gt;&lt;P&gt;&amp;nbsp;Thanks&lt;/P&gt;</description>
      <pubDate>Fri, 13 Feb 2026 15:31:43 GMT</pubDate>
      <guid>https://community.nxp.com/t5/i-MX-Processors/IMX8QM-Display-port/m-p/2317922#M244029</guid>
      <dc:creator>Rbe78</dc:creator>
      <dc:date>2026-02-13T15:31:43Z</dc:date>
    </item>
  </channel>
</rss>

